Pillars of Society (film)

Pillars of Society is a 1920 British silent drama film directed by Rex Wilson and starring Ellen Terry, Norman McKinnel and Mary Rorke.[1] It was based on the 1877 play The Pillars of Society by Henrik Ibsen. Location shooting was done in Norway.
